About This Pub
You know, Grace Kelly's in Tynemouth is one of those places that really captures the spirit of an Irish lounge, with its lively atmosphere, live music, and quiz nights that make for a brilliant night. The staff are genuinely warm and on hand to fix any snags, like when someone had a kitchen issue but ended up with fabulous food and outstanding service – it's touches like that which make it stand out. They've got a solid range of drinks too, and it's such a welcoming spot if you're exploring the area for the first time. On the flip side, though, the prices are a tad high for what you get; hearing about £10 for a simple pint and a coke made me wince, as it put off a group who might have stayed longer otherwise. Then there are the gripes about the toilets being in a poor state and the place feeling understaffed on Saturdays, which could spoil the fun if you're not prepared. All in all, it's a gem for a good time by the coast, but keep an eye on the costs and maybe check it's not too hectic before you head in.
